The Plant and Its Key Compounds
This section introduces the botany in plain language: milk thistle is a spiny flowering plant in the Asteraceae family, with distinctive purple blooms and white-veined leaves. The part most often used in supplements is the seed. From those seeds comes a standardized extract commonly referred to as silymarin, a mixture of flavonolignans. One of the best-known components is silybin (also spelled silibinin), frequently used as a marker compound when manufacturers standardize products. Readers will get a practical explanation of why standardization matters. Whole-seed powders, tinctures, and standardized extracts can differ widely in active compound content. The topic can cover how labels typically express standardization (for example, “standardized to X% silymarin”) and why that number alone does not guarantee quality. It also introduces basic quality signals: third-party testing, clear identification of plant part used, and transparent dosing information. What Research Suggests About Liver Support
Here the topic turns to evidence in a careful, non-sensational way. Milk thistle has been studied for its antioxidant and anti-inflammatory properties and for potential effects on liver enzymes and markers of liver stress. The blog can summarize what clinical research has explored: use in people with elevated liver enzymes, non-alcoholic fatty liver disease, medication-related liver strain, and other conditions where the liver is under metabolic pressure. It should also note that results across studies are mixed, and differences in product type, dose, and study design make comparisons difficult. This section can explain what outcomes matter to clinicians and patients: changes in ALT and AST, imaging findings in fatty liver, symptom reports, and overall safety. It should emphasize that improved lab numbers do not automatically mean a cure, and that underlying causes such as diet quality, weight management, and blood sugar control remain central. The reader should leave with a balanced view: there is enough research to justify interest, but not enough to treat milk thistle as a stand-alone solution.
How to Choose and Use It Responsibly
This section makes the topic highly practical. It can outline common forms: standardized capsules or tablets, seed powder, and liquid extracts. It can explain why many studies use standardized extracts rather than raw powder, and how that affects expectations. The blog can also discuss typical label details readers should look for: the amount per serving, standardization percentage, and whether the product lists silybin content. It can suggest keeping a simple log for a few weeks—energy, digestion comfort, and any side effects—while reminding readers that subjective changes are not a diagnostic tool. It should include clear safety guidance. Milk thistle is generally well tolerated for many adults, but it can cause digestive upset in some people and may trigger allergic reactions in those sensitive to plants in the daisy family. The topic should stress checking with a clinician or pharmacist if someone is pregnant, breastfeeding, managing chronic conditions, or taking multiple medications, because herb–drug interactions are possible. The section can also recommend choosing products with batch testing and avoiding “proprietary blends” that hide exact amounts.
